> > > diff --git a/originator.c b/originator.c
> > > index 5d53d2f..acc0c2d 100644
> > > --- a/originator.c
> > > +++ b/originator.c
> > > @@ -257,6 +257,9 @@ struct batadv_orig_node *batadv_get_orig_node(struct batadv_priv *bat_priv,
> > > reset_time = jiffies - 1 - msecs_to_jiffies(BATADV_RESET_PROTECTION_MS);
> > > orig_node->bcast_seqno_reset = reset_time;
> > > orig_node->batman_seqno_reset = reset_time;
> > > +#ifdef CONFIG_BATMAN_ADV_MCAST_OPTIMIZATIONS
> > > + orig_node->mcast_flags = BATADV_MCAST_LISTENER_ANNOUNCEMENT;
> > > +#endif
> >
> > why do you start assuming that an originator has the optimisation enabled? would
> > it be better to wait for the first mcast tvlv from it to claim this?
>
> Because it is easier code-wise. I had it the other way round first
> and issuing an atomic_inc(&bat_priv->mcast_num_non_ware) in
> batadv_get_orig_node(), but then I ended up counting up too many
> times because I was increasing that counter for secondary
> interface originators, too while not decreasing it again because
> no TVLV handler will be called for these. And within
> batadv_get_orig_node() I don't see an easy way to determine
> whether I was called for a primary or secondary interface
> originator.
>
mh..I don't really understand this (maybe because I don't have a deep knowledge
of this code). My idea was to start with:
orig_node->mcast_flags = BATADV_NO_FLAGS;
and to set
orig_node->mcast_flags = BATADV_MCAST_LISTENER_ANNOUNCEMENT;
only in the received TVLV parsing function (if any TVLV has been received).
Is this inconsistent with what you have in the code?
